Crabapple Boutique Garden
Crabapple Boutique Garden, located at the west side of park and covering an area of about 12600m2, was constructed in 1999. Mochou's Couplet Corridor
Mochous Couplet Corridor, located at the south bank of Mochou Lake and 125m long, was constructed in wood structure in 2007.
